“Emul, we need to grind”: Shangri-La Frontier’s Protagonist is a Better Mc Than Luffy and Goku Because It Avoids a Shonen Pitfall That Affects Every Anime

Every year, anime fans receive a flood of new seasonal releases, so it is rather challenging to track down the gems. Shangri-La Frontier premiered in the fall of 2023 and quickly turned out to exceed everyone’s expectations. This is no surprise given the expansive lore of the anime.
Sunraku from Shangri-La Frontier anime| Credits: Studio C2C
With Season 2, Shangri-La Frontier returns stronger than ever, building on Season 1’s momentum and creating a buzz online. Blending gaming and fantasy themes, this thrilling series offers lovable characters and an engaging storyline that keeps fans hooked.
Along with thrilling action and impressive video game elements, Shangri-La Frontier stands out thanks to its protagonist, Sunraku, who single-handedly carries the series as the perfect lead.
What makes Shangri-La Frontier’s Sunraku the ultimate Mc
Shangri-La Frontier is an exciting anime series starring Sunraku as he looks to play his first ever ‘good game’ in the titular Shangri-La Frontier.
